Cannabis is grown from one of 2 sources: a seed or a clone. Seeds bring genetic information from 2 moms and dad plants and can express various combinations of traits: some from the mother, some from the father, and some traits from both. In business cannabis production, usually, growers will plant numerous seeds of one strain and select the very best plant. You can likewise minimize headaches and prevent the trouble of seed germination and sexing plants by beginning with clones.
A clone is a cutting that is genetically identical to the plant it was taken fromthat plant is referred to as the "mom." Through cloning, you can develop a brand-new harvest with specific reproductions of your favorite plant. Because genetics are similar, a clone will offer you a plant with the exact same qualities as the mom, such as taste, cannabinoid profile, yield, grow time, and so on. So if you stumble upon a specific stress or phenotype you really like, you may wish to clone it to recreate more buds that have the same results and characteristics. Feminized cannabis seeds will produce only female plants for getting buds, so there is no requirement to remove males or stress over female plants getting pollinated. Feminized seeds are produced by causing the monoecious condition in a female marijuana plantthe resulting seeds are nearly identical to the self-pollinated female parent, as only one set of genes is present.

They are easy to grow because you do not need to stress over light cycles and just how much light a plant gets. The majority of cannabis plants start blooming when the amount of light they get every day lowers. Outdoors, this happens when the sun begins setting earlier in the day as the season turns from summer season to fall. Indoor growers can control when a plant flowers by decreasing the daily quantity of light plants receive from 18 hours to 12 hours - feminized weed seeds.

CBD, or cannabidiol, is one of the chemical componentsknown jointly as cannabinoidsfound in the cannabis plant. For many years, humans have picked plants for high-THC material, making cannabis with high levels of CBD unusual. The genetic pathways through which THC is manufactured by the plant are various than those for CBD production. Cannabis used for hemp production has actually been selected for other traits, including a low THC material, so as to abide by the 2018 Farm Costs.
As interest in CBD as a medicine has grown, numerous breeders have crossed high-CBD hemp with marijuana. These stress have little or no THC, 1:1 ratios of THC and CBD, or some have a high-THC material in addition to considerable quantities of CBD (3% or more). Marijuana seeds require 3 things to sprout: water, heat, and air. There are many methods to sprout seeds, however for the most common and easiest technique, you will need: 2 clean plates, 4 paper towels, Seeds, Pure water Take four sheets of paper towels and soak them with distilled water. The towels should be soaked however should not have excess water running.
Then, put the cannabis seeds a minimum of an inch apart from each other and cover them with the staying two water-soaked paper towels. To produce a dark, secured space, take another plate and flip it over to cover the seeds, like a dome. Make certain the area the seeds are in is warm, somewhere in between 70-85F. After completing these steps, it's time to wait. Check the paper towels once a day to ensure they're still saturated, and if they are losing moisture, apply more water to keep the seeds pleased - autoflower marijuana seeds. Some seeds germinate really quickly while others can take a while, but typically, seeds need to germinate in 3-10 days.
A seed has sprouted as soon as the seed divides and a single grow appears. The grow is the taproot, which will end up being the primary stem of the plant, and seeing it is an indication of effective germination. It's crucial to keep the fragile seed sterilized, so do not touch the seed or taproot as it begins to divide.
